CI note: RateLens parity checker — flaky comparison stage. The nightly job on the Verno runners intermittently fails when the Brightmoor Suites fixture returns stale cached rates, causing false parity mismatches. We traced it to the fixture server warming up slower than the 5s health probe allows; bumping the probe timeout to 20s resolved three consecutive runs. If this recurs, check the cache-priming step before blaming the diff engine itself. For reference, the last known-good pipeline run carries this token.

pipeline stamp: htk31_f769b577b3028a4e9958e5bb8d1259a

## Deploying the Gatewick Proctor Queue

Deploys are pretty painless: push to main, wait for the pipeline, then watch the queue drain dashboard for five minutes. If candidates pile up mid-exam, roll back first and ask questions later — the queue replays safely. Everything the workers care about lives in one config block, shown here for reference.

settings of bafof-yagef:
JOROX_PIN=8740
JOROX_TENANT=pelox
JOROX_METRICS_HOST=metrics.jorox.qorvelworks.internal
JOROX_SEAL=seal_c78f63c1
JOROX_STANDBY_TEAM=norax

Managers-Only Wiki: Currency Hedging Decision – Tidemark Goods

Quick summary for the board. With roughly 40% of our costs now invoiced in crowns, we've decided to hedge 12 months forward rather than ride the spot market. Treasury modelled three scenarios; the forward-contract route came out cheapest under all but the rosiest case. Petra's team will review quarterly and unwind early if rates swing our way. It's not glamorous, but it buys predictability for the Ashvale expansion. The sensitive bit for board eyes only sits below.

board note of yadup-fajef: Druiusox Holdings is in early talks to buy Norwynek Systems for about $186.0 million. The Kaseth launch date is June 24, and nothing goes to the press before then. Legal wants the Quenethek Group term sheet withdrawn before November 27.